The role of the Relationship Director is a full relationship management role to engage with our existing and prospective customers to help them realise their ambitions. Your key aim as a Relationship Director with HSBC will be operate person of influence to our customers with a turnover of between 15M and 350M, where you will also be responsible for customer service excellence to our existing and prospective customers.
Customer portfolios will consist of both domestic and international relationships and will involve managing all aspects of the relationship including operational and credit risk. To be successful in this role you will create and maintain strong and evolving partnerships internally and externally.
Your responsibilities will include:
- Focus on growing the business sustainably, by identifying opportunities to expand a portfolio and broadening client relationships by leveraging HSBC's extensive network.
- Be an ambassador for HSBC and develop the bank’s profile in the local business and wider community.
- Supporting customers and placing their needs at the forefront of all that we do, setting world class standards.
- Seeking new opportunities and nurturing existing relationships to identify new business opportunities.
- Building a network of business introducers in the local professional and business community.
- Adhere to structures and processes in place for the management of credit, operational, reputation, financial crime and regulatory risk.
- Collaborate with product partners to assess needs of international and domestic customers and offer appropriate solutions.
The ideal candidate for this role will have:
- Experience working in a relevant role within Corporate Banking/Financial Services is essential.
- Proven ability in identifying and meeting customer’s needs and generating complex lending both monetary and applying appropriate products and solutions to help customers realise their dreams and ambitions.
- Ability to build effective networks across business areas, developing relationships based on mutual trust and encouraging others to do the same.
- A comprehensive understanding of risk management and proven experience of ensuring own/others' compliance with relevant regulatory processes.
- Corporate coverage experience with a knowledge of the UK Consumer and Industrials market is essential.
- Credit skills and cashflow and asset-based lending experience is essential.
- Highly skilled at building and managing complex relationships.
- Self-driven with the ability to manage conflicting priorities and work collaboratively to deliver to deadlines.
This is a hybrid position with the base location being Queen Victoria Street, London. This role requires an element of travel for client meetings, mostly around the London region and into Surrey. It is therefore important that the successful candidate can travel and is within an easily commutable distance of this region.
